Police seek help locating missing teenage girl in Newark

1 min read

NEWARK, NJ — Police are asking for the public’s help in locating a missing 17-year-old girl.

Jarolin Jimenez, of Newark, was reported missing on Thursday.

She was last seen in the 400 block of Avon Avenue on Friday, Dec. 12, at approximately 5 p.m.

Jimenez is Hispanic, 5’5″ tall, 120 pounds, with brown hair and brown eyes.

She was wearing a black jacket, white sweater and carrying a book bag.

Her family believes she may be in Brooklyn.
